About the Role

This position is with PCI Private Limited, a proud member of the Celestica family.

Headquartered in Singapore, PCI is an established global Electronics Manufacturing Services (EMS) provider. For over 50 years, we have delivered reliable end-to-end design, supply chain, and engineering solutions to top-tier international brands, combining our deep industry expertise with operational excellence across our regional footprint.

As part of the Celestica group, this role offers the unique opportunity to work within a close-knit, agile business environment while enjoying the global stability, reach, and network of a world-class technology leader.

Location: Laguna, Philippines (Currently WFH until office is set up; Office location yet to be confirmed, will be around Laguna area)

Responsibilities:

  • Demonstrates strong, in-depth expertise in the Industrial business segment and pricing methodologies.
  • Accountable for delivering competitive material pricing solutions to support growth and margins as per company objectives.
  • Collaborates with the global customer unit, customers, program management, business proposal leads, finance, and/or sales to determine material pricing strategies.
  • Aligns on trade-offs between proposal cycle time, solution precision, and scope with clients to deliver an agreed-upon price strategy.
  • Project manages supply chain solutions with commodity management, costing teams, and engineering teams to deliver desired pricing and margin solutions.
  • Prepares material pricing solutions for new business opportunities (bids) and manages ongoing pricing through the lifecycle of the product (repricing), including the generation of Bills of Materials, cost-competitive analyses, and margin recommendations.
  • Provides insights and recommendations to support external (customer or supplier) negotiations.
  • Presents proposed solutions to key stakeholders.
  • Performs cost-takedown trend analyses and modeling to leverage insights in service requests.
  • Conducts market research and generates product teardowns to enable competitiveness assessments in service requests.
  • Proactively drives continuous improvement in margin expansion, cycle time, pricing competitiveness, pricing tactics, and process efficiency.

Requirements:

  • A Degree in Engineering, Business Management, or a relevant field of studies.
  • At least 3–5 years of working experience in the Industrial segment within an EMS or MNC environment.
  • Experience should include cost analysis skills, as well as knowledge of material pricing and strategy.
  • Good supply base knowledge of Mechanical and Electro-Mechanical commodities, such as plastics, cables, connectors, modules, PCBs, etc.
  • Proven experience in successful VA/VE proposals.
  • Knowledge of SAP & Polydyne is an added advantage; familiarity with Microsoft Office is a prerequisite.
  • Strong analytical skills.
  • Ability to negotiate and be self-confident; able to work independently and with minimal supervision.
  • Strong proficiency in English (both spoken and written) to communicate with stakeholders.
